DECISION-MAKING STYLES AS PREDICTORS OF SUBJECTIVE WELL-BEING. (English)
- Abstract:
We examined the relationship between decision-making styles and subjective well-being. We expected that decision-making styles will predict well-being, even when controlling the influence of demographic variables and personality traits and that decision outcomes would further explain well-being. Data were collected from. 189 adult participants that answered the Zuckerman-Kuhlmanov Personality Questionnaire (ZKPQ), the Mental Health Continuum (MHC-SF) and the Decision Outcome Inventory (DOI). Demographic variables didn't predict well-being. Personality traits explained from 16 to 29 %, decision-making styles from 6 to 11 % and decision outcomes up to 2 % of the variance of well-being. According to expectations rational and intuitive styles predicted higher and the avoidant style predicted lower well-being. Contrary to predictions, the spontaneous style predicted higher well-being. PREUCEVALI SMO ODNOS MED stili odločanja in psihičnim blagostanjem. Predvidevali smo, da bodo stili odločanja napovedovali blagostanje, tudi ob nadzorovanju vpliva demografskih spremenljivk in osebnostnih lastno-sti. Posledice odločitev pa bodo dodatno pojasnile psihično blagostanje. V raziskavi je sodelovalo 189 odraslih udeležencev. Izpolnili so Zuckerman--Kuhlmanov vprašalnik osebnosti ZKPQ, Vprašalnik duševnega zdravja MHC-SF in Vprašalnik posledic odločitev DOI. Demografske značilnosti niso pojasnile pomembnega deleža variance blagostanja. Osebnostne značilnosti so pojasnile od 16 do 29 %, stili odločanja od 6 do 11 %, napačne odločitve pa do največ 2 % variance blagostanja. Skladno s pričakovanji sta racio-nalni in intuitivni stil odločanja napovedovala višje, izogibajoči pa nižje psihično blagostanje. V nasprotju s pričakovanji je spontani stil odločanja napovedoval višje psihično blagostanje.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
